11 digit ndc lookup - The NDC, or National Drug Code, is a unique 10-digit or 11-digit, 3-segment number, and a universal product identifier for human drugs in the United States. The 3 segments of the NDC identify: the labeler, the product, and the commercial package size.

Drug products are identified and reported using a unique, three-segment number, called the National Drug Code (NDC), which serves as a universal product identifier for drugs. This number identifies the labeler, product, and trade package size. The first segment, the labeler code, is assigned by the FDA.The NDC is reported in an 11-digit format, which is divided into three sections. The first five digits indicate the manufacturer or the labeler; the next four digits indicate the ingredient, strength, dosage form and route of administration; and the last two digits indicate the packaging.Search the National Drug Code Directory with our fast and easy to use look-up tool. Once you have identified the format as either 4-4-2, 5-3-2 or 5-4-1, insert a zero according to the following table. 10-digit format Add a zero in… Report NDC as… 4-4-2 *####-####-## 1stOct 16, 2018 · The FDA notes that since a zero can be a valid digit in the NDC, confusion may result when trying to reconstitute the NDC back to the FDA 10-digit standard format. For example: 12345-0678-09 (11 digits) could be 12345-678-09 or 12345-0678-9 depending on the firm’s configuration. NDC use. NDC numbers are used on a widespread basis. Food and Drug Administration. The FDA held a public hearing on November 5, 2018, regarding the future format of the National Drug Code (NDC). An NDC is a unique 10-digit, 3-segment identifier ...
